Turbo manifold experience?

Has anyone heard anything or has a Megan turbo manifold on there evo? I was looking into getting one...but why are they so cheap?

alot of people have good luck with them other dont and they crack...i would just get the stock one ported

i had the megan on my car nothing abnormal no huge power gains or spool reduction the stock one ported as the above dood posted is the right way to go ,, the biggest difference IMO was the exhaust sound changed quite a bit ,, and when i didnt have a heat shield on it(the megan) i had trouble with the car overheating at lapping days,, not worth the trouble.

agreed... ported stock is the way to go on a stock framed turbo!! and its just as cheap really... you could do it yourself if you have the tools and time... you will get faster spool, more flow!!

megan is a hit or miss, it either fits and makes decent power, or comes horrible and the ports don't match the head etc etc. I would agree to port and coat the stocker.
